A barangay (Filipino: baranggay, [baraŋˈɡaj]), also known by its former Spanish adopted name, the barrio, is the smallest administrative division in the Philippines and is the native Filipino term for a village, district or ward.

What is the definition of the word Barangay?

In the Philippines, a barangay is the smallest administrative division, similar to a village or neighborhood. It is the primary unit of governance in the country, and it is headed by a Barangay captain. Barangays are responsible for providing basic services to the community, such as maintaining peace and order, collecting local taxes, and delivering social services.
